Source:BooleanExpressionParserTest.java Github

copy

Full Screen

...19import com.consol.citrus.exceptions.CitrusRuntimeException;20/**21 * @author Christoph Deppisch22 */23public class BooleanExpressionParserTest {24 25 @Test26 public void testExpressionParser() {27 Assert.assertTrue(BooleanExpressionParser.evaluate("1 = 1"));28 Assert.assertFalse(BooleanExpressionParser.evaluate("1 = 2"));29 Assert.assertTrue(BooleanExpressionParser.evaluate("1 lt 2"));30 Assert.assertFalse(BooleanExpressionParser.evaluate("2 lt 1"));31 Assert.assertTrue(BooleanExpressionParser.evaluate("2 gt 1"));32 Assert.assertFalse(BooleanExpressionParser.evaluate("1 gt 2"));33 Assert.assertTrue(BooleanExpressionParser.evaluate("2 lt= 2"));34 Assert.assertTrue(BooleanExpressionParser.evaluate("2 gt= 2"));35 Assert.assertFalse(BooleanExpressionParser.evaluate("2 lt= 1"));36 Assert.assertFalse(BooleanExpressionParser.evaluate("2 gt= 3"));37 Assert.assertTrue(BooleanExpressionParser.evaluate("(1 = 1)"));38 Assert.assertTrue(BooleanExpressionParser.evaluate("(1 = 1) and (2 = 2)"));39 Assert.assertTrue(BooleanExpressionParser.evaluate("(1 lt= 1) and (2 gt= 2)"));40 Assert.assertTrue(BooleanExpressionParser.evaluate("(1 gt 2) or (2 = 2)"));41 Assert.assertTrue(BooleanExpressionParser.evaluate("((1 = 5) and (2 = 6)) or (2 gt 1)"));42 Assert.assertFalse(BooleanExpressionParser.evaluate("(1 = 2)"));43 Assert.assertFalse(BooleanExpressionParser.evaluate("(1 = 1) and (2 = 3)"));44 Assert.assertFalse(BooleanExpressionParser.evaluate("(1 lt 1) and (2 gt 2)"));45 Assert.assertFalse(BooleanExpressionParser.evaluate("(1 gt 2) or (2 = 3)"));46 Assert.assertFalse(BooleanExpressionParser.evaluate("((1 = 5) and (2 = 6)) or (2 lt 1)"));47 Assert.assertTrue(BooleanExpressionParser.evaluate("true"));48 Assert.assertTrue(BooleanExpressionParser.evaluate("true = true"));49 Assert.assertTrue(BooleanExpressionParser.evaluate("false = false"));50 Assert.assertFalse(BooleanExpressionParser.evaluate("false"));51 Assert.assertFalse(BooleanExpressionParser.evaluate("true = false"));52 Assert.assertFalse(BooleanExpressionParser.evaluate("false = true"));53 Assert.assertTrue(BooleanExpressionParser.evaluate("( false = false ) and ( true = true )"));54 Assert.assertFalse(BooleanExpressionParser.evaluate("( false = false ) and ( true = false )"));55 }56 57 @Test58 public void testExpressionParserWithUnknownOperator() {59 try {60 BooleanExpressionParser.evaluate("wahr");61 } catch(CitrusRuntimeException e) {62 Assert.assertEquals(e.getLocalizedMessage(), "Unknown operator 'wahr'");63 return;64 }65 66 Assert.fail("Missing " + CitrusRuntimeException.class + " because of unknown operator");67 }68 69 @Test70 public void testExpressionParserWithBrokenExpression() {71 try {72 BooleanExpressionParser.evaluate("1 = ");73 } catch(CitrusRuntimeException e) {74 Assert.assertEquals(e.getLocalizedMessage(), "Unable to parse boolean expression '1 = '. Maybe expression is incomplete!");75 return;76 }77 78 Assert.fail("Missing " + CitrusRuntimeException.class + " because of broken expression");79 }80}...
